Linksys WUSB600N (EU) Specifications

General IconGeneral
Wireless Data RatesUp to 300 Mbps
Frequency Band2.4 GHz, 5 GHz
InterfaceUSB 2.0
SecurityWEP, WPA, WPA2
AntennaInternal
Operating Systems SupportedWindows XP, Windows Vista, Windows 7
Wireless StandardIEEE 802.11a/g/n
